The Timeless Appeal of Lace

Lace has long been associated with luxury, elegance, and sensuality in intimate wear. It is a fabric that enhances the aesthetic appeal of lingerie, making it a popular choice for delicate and intricate designs. Its lightweight nature and ability to create detailed patterns allow brands to craft visually striking pieces that highlight femininity and sophistication.

Beyond its decorative aspect, lace has evolved with modern textile advancements to improve comfort and durability. Stretch lace, for instance, incorporates elastic fibers to offer flexibility and a better fit, catering to consumers who seek both style and wearability. Lace lingerie is particularly favored in special occasion wear, as it conveys romance and refinement.

Sustainability is also influencing the production of lace, with brands now incorporating recycled and eco-friendly fibers. This shift aligns with the growing demand for intimate wear that balances beauty with ethical manufacturing practices. While lace remains a premium fabric, innovations in its composition are making it more accessible and comfortable for everyday use.

The Luxury and Sophistication of Silk

Silk is synonymous with opulence and indulgence, making it a preferred fabric for high-end intimate wear. Its naturally smooth and lightweight texture offers a luxurious feel against the skin, making it a staple in premium lingerie collections. Silk’s ability to regulate temperature further enhances its appeal, keeping wearers cool in warmer conditions and warm in cooler climates.

One of the key advantages of silk is its breathability and moisture-wicking properties, which contribute to all-day comfort. This makes it an attractive option for sleepwear, robes, and premium lingerie sets. The natural sheen of silk adds to its elegance, making it a desirable choice for those seeking both comfort and sophistication.

Despite its luxurious qualities, silk requires delicate care, which can be a consideration for consumers who prioritize easy maintenance. In response, brands have introduced silk blends that retain the fabric’s softness while improving durability and affordability. Additionally, the rise of ethical fashion has prompted the development of plant-based and cruelty-free silk alternatives, catering to consumers who seek sustainable options.

The Everyday Comfort of Cotton

Cotton remains a staple in the intimate wear market due to its unmatched comfort, breathability, and versatility. As a natural fiber, it is soft on the skin, making it an ideal choice for daily wear. Its moisture-absorbing properties help keep the body dry, reducing the risk of irritation and discomfort. These characteristics make cotton a preferred fabric for basics, including everyday bras, briefs, and loungewear.

The increasing demand for organic and sustainably sourced cotton reflects a broader consumer shift toward environmentally responsible choices. Many brands now offer lingerie collections made from organic cotton, which is free from synthetic pesticides and chemicals, providing an eco-friendly alternative for conscious shoppers. This aligns with the rising preference for intimate wear that supports both personal well-being and environmental sustainability.

In addition to its comfort, cotton is known for its durability and ease of maintenance. Unlike more delicate fabrics, cotton garments can withstand frequent washing without losing their shape or softness, making them a practical choice for everyday lingerie. Its ability to blend with other materials also allows brands to create innovative fabric combinations that enhance stretch, support, and durability.
